Transaction 8d3852f2306ab8d2174f7356566232aa9e1e39a38ee42b573b3cf42bbe34bb65
1 Input
1 Output
-
8d3852f2306ab8d2174f7356566232aa9e1e39a38ee42b573b3cf42bbe34bb65:0
- value
- 6626284
- script pubkey
- OP_0 OP_PUSHBYTES_20 fca6fea8f3e6eb66a36bdf1262d2794c00d273ed
- address
- bc1qljn0a28num4kdgmtmufx95nefsqdyuldqhrxu0